Andrew Lenox is a software engineering manager with 15 years of industry experience and 12 years leading teams to ship native apps, web platforms, and data engineering products into production. Currently at GameChanger after guiding research-to-product work at the University of Michigan and directing advanced projects at startups like Tome, he excels in small-company environments where broad responsibility and rapid delivery are required. He focuses on building high-performance teams through humane management that reduces developer toil and increases workplace joy, while retaining hands-on technical credibility from mobile and backend engineering roles. Based in Flint, Michigan, Andrew combines product-minded leadership with deep operational experience managing the full lifecycle from prototyping to production. An underrated strength is his consistent track record of translating academic research and experimental projects into production-ready systems.
